House Bill 5557 of 2000 (Public Act 304 of 2000)

Sponsors

Categories

Criminal procedure: sentencing guidelines; Crimes: controlled substances; Controlled substances: other
Criminal procedure; sentencing guidelines; sentencing guidelines for certain crimes involving manufacturing, delivering, possessing with intent to deliver, or possessing gamma-butyrolactone; enact. Amends secs. 13 & 18, ch. XVII of 1927 PA 175 (MCL 777.13 & 777.18). TIE BAR WITH: HB 5556'00
